Excel VLOOKUP函数:跨表查找和引用数据的教程
在Excel中,VLOOKUP函数是一个非常强大的工具,它可以帮助我们在不同的表之间查找和引用数据。通过使用VLOOKUP函数,你可以轻松地匹配和获取数据,从而大大提高工作效率。以下是关于如何使用VLOOKUP函数进行跨表查找和引用数据的详细教程。
一、VLOOKUP函数的基本语法
VLOOKUP函数的语法如下:
V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
其中:
- lookup_value:要在表格中查找的值。
- table_array:要在其中查找的表格或区域。
- col_index_num:要返回的列的索引号。
- [range_lookup]:可选参数,表示是否要执行近似匹配。如果设置为TRUE,则返回与lookup_value最接近的值;如果设置为FALSE,则只返回精确匹配的值。
二、跨表查找和引用数据的步骤
- 打开Excel工作簿,并确保要查找和引用的数据在不同的工作表中。
- 在需要输入数据的工作表中,选择一个单元格。
- 输入VLOOKUP函数,并按照以下顺序输入参数: a. lookup_value:选择一个单元格,该单元格包含要在另一个表中查找的值。例如,如果要在“Sheet2”的A列中查找“Apple”,则可以选择“Sheet2”中的A2单元格。 b. table_array:选择包含要查找数据的表或区域。例如,如果要在“Sheet2”中查找数据,则可以选择“Sheet2”中的A1:B10区域。 c. col_index_num:选择要返回的列的索引号。例如,如果要在“Sheet2”中返回B列中的值,则索引号应为2。 d. [range_lookup]:根据需要选择是否执行近似匹配。如果设置为TRUE,则返回与lookup_value最接近的值;如果设置为FALSE,则只返回精确匹配的值。
- 按下Enter键,Excel将自动查找并返回所需的数据。
三、示例
假设我们有两个工作表:“Sheet1”和“Sheet2”。在“Sheet1”中,我们有一个产品列表,包括产品名称、数量和单价。在“Sheet2”中,我们有一个客户列表,包括客户名称和所需的数量。我们想要根据客户名称在“Sheet2”中找到对应的数量,并将其引用到“Sheet1”中。
步骤如下:
- 在“Sheet1”中,选择一个单元格(例如B2),输入以下公式:=VLOOKUP(A2, Sheet2!A:C, 2, FALSE)。这个公式将在“Sheet2”的A列中查找与“Sheet1”的A2单元格中的值相匹配的值,并返回对应的B列中的值。
- 按下Enter键,Excel将自动填充B列中的其他单元格,并将对应的数据从“Sheet2”引用到“Sheet1”中。
- 如果需要引用其他列的数据,只需将公式中的列号更改即可。例如,要引用C列中的数据,将公式更改为=VLOOKUP(A2, Sheet2!A:C, 3, FALSE)。
通过使用VLOOKUP函数,你可以轻松地在不同的表之间查找和引用数据,从而提高工作效率和准确性。希望这个教程能够帮助你更好地理解和使用VLOOKUP函数。